Sql server SQL Server安装程序虚拟或物理

Sql server SQL Server安装程序虚拟或物理,sql-server,Sql Server,我们正在建立新的数据库服务器,但需要一些帮助,我们是否应该去虚拟托管路线或物理路线。以下是背景信息: 数据库:SQL Server 2016和SSRS 该系统将由最多200名并发用户集中托管,全球用户将访问该系统。在未来,并发用户的数量可能会增加到300个 Infra团队向我保证,他们将设置专用数据库服务器,但他们希望在其上托管虚拟服务器,因为从灾难恢复的角度来看,这更有利。 开发团队更喜欢使用物理服务器,因为当出现问题和需要调查时,它使生活变得简单 我希望你能为我提供一些指导,或者为我指出这个

我们正在建立新的数据库服务器,但需要一些帮助,我们是否应该去虚拟托管路线或物理路线。以下是背景信息:

数据库:SQL Server 2016和SSRS 该系统将由最多200名并发用户集中托管,全球用户将访问该系统。在未来,并发用户的数量可能会增加到300个

Infra团队向我保证,他们将设置专用数据库服务器,但他们希望在其上托管虚拟服务器,因为从灾难恢复的角度来看,这更有利。 开发团队更喜欢使用物理服务器,因为当出现问题和需要调查时,它使生活变得简单

我希望你能为我提供一些指导,或者为我指出这个进退两难的正确方向


非常感谢。

史蒂夫·马修斯(Steve Matthews)指出,您省略了有关该应用程序的所有重要细节。但在现实生活中,虚拟机在生产应用程序中的使用非常非常广泛,包括使用VMWARE产品和HyperV(Microsoft产品)。虽然与直接在机器上运行相比,您可能会损失3-10%的性能,但在虚拟机上运行有很多好处(管理员可以在需要和可用时轻松分配更多内存、CPU和其他资源)

另一种越来越流行的方法是使用Azure(即“云”)进行虚拟化。在这里,你也可以随着应用程序需求的变化添加各种资源,但当然你将为此收取费用。当您使用AZURE时,产品的某些部分无法运行-请参见此

您可能还希望从Microsoft中看到以下内容:

但是,包括备份在内的大部分管理工作都可以由Azure完成,这使得Azure对许多商店非常有吸引力


无论你走哪条路,祝你好运。

我认为这个问题没有“正确”的答案。了解最大并发用户数只是难题的一小部分。数据库大小、事务计数、数据库数量等。。。此外,您还需要了解在任何一种环境中托管它的硬件的相关信息,以及所需的灾难恢复/故障切换要求。感谢您的反馈。抱歉,我不清楚,我想知道的是,设置在主机上创建单个VM实例并添加额外的复杂性层,而不是直接在物理层上托管,是否有任何好处。我同意虚拟机的好处,如果主机要加载多个虚拟机实例,这是有意义的,但在我们的例子中,它加载的是单个虚拟机?谢谢